Summary

This position consists of 36 hours per week.

The CNA-M is responsible for administering medications accurately and in a timely manner to patients / residents who are 14 years or older.

The CNA-M completes a 120 hour medication course and upon passing the state exam, is permitted to administer medications in a health care facility under the direction and supervision of a licensed nurse.
